History of Slot Machines<\/h2>\n

Slot machines have a rich and fascinating history that dates back to the late 1800s. The first mechanical slot machine was invented by Charles Fey in 1895, featuring three reels and symbols like horseshoes and diamonds. Over time, these machines evolved from simple mechanical devices to electronic wonders. The introduction of video slots in the 1970s and the rise of online slots in the 2000s transformed the industry. Today, slot machines are a cornerstone of both land-based and online casinos in the USA.<\/p>\n

The slot machine history is also intertwined with American pop culture. From the iconic Liberty Bell machine to modern progressive jackpots, these games have shaped entertainment and gambling landscapes. Understanding this history helps players appreciate the innovation behind modern slot machines.<\/p>\n

How Slot Machines Work<\/h2>\n

At their core, slot machines operate using a random number generator (RNG) to determine outcomes. Each spin generates a sequence of numbers that correspond to symbols on the reels. The RNG ensures that every spin is independent, making it impossible to predict results. Modern slot machines also use advanced software to manage paylines, bonuses, and graphics.<\/p>\n
